Gender: Boy
Meaning: Charcoal burner, from the plough blade
Origin: English/German
Popularity: Ranked #835 in 2024 with 296 babies born.
History: Kolter surged in the 2020s as a K-spelling surname-name. The name sounds like it belongs on a ranch or a roster. Kolter represents the American frontier naming trend — names that project rugged capability.
Name length: 6 letters
How common is Kolter? About 1 in 11,245 babies born in 2024 were named Kolter, or roughly 0.8 per day in the United States.
